West Ham United v Fulham, 09 October 2022

Score3-1 to West Ham United
RefereeChris Kavanagh
CompetitionPremier League
VenueLondon Stadium
Attendance62,454
Kick-off: 2.00pm Premier League Head to Head Played: 25 West Ham United won: 15 Drawn: 6 Fulham won: 4 West Ham United scored: 43 Fulham scored: 25 West Ham United remained unbeaten in their last 12 home games in the Premier League against Fulham (won eight).

3 West Ham United

Manager: David Moyes

1 Fulham

Manager: Marco Silva

Goals:

Jarrod Bowen penalty 29 P
Gianluca Scamacca 62 G
Michail Antonio 90 G

Goals:

Andreas Pereira 5 G

Comments:

League position: 13th West Ham United had now won consecutive games in the Premier League for the first time since 1 January 2022. The Hammers had now scored two goals in the first-half of their nine games so far in this Premier League season. Jarrod Bowen had now scored 19 of his 23 goals in the Premier League at the London Stadium.

Comments:

League position: 9th Fulham failed in their attempt to win consecutive away games in the Premier League for the first time since August 2014. The Whites had now won one of their last 28 games in the Premier League against London opposition (lost 22). They had now kept a clean sheet in one of last 19 games in the Premier League.
